Producer: Dehours et Fils
The Dehours Champagne Brut Grande Reserve is the result of an assemblage of Meunier, Pinot Noir and Chardonnay, with a great percentage of vin de rèserve, fermented according to Solera methods, embraced by Jerome in 1998.
Producer: Bouquin Dupont Fils
A wonderful champagne, 100% Chardonnay of Avize from vineyards more than 60 years old. A base of citrus fruit melted with the scent, and taste, of a custard where there are also two drops of lemon juice. Delicious and enjoyable.

Producer: Dehours et Fils
The Champagne Rosè Oeil de Pedrix is the result of an assemblage of Meunier and Chardonnay from old vineyards. Flowery Champagne Rosè Extra Brut, particularly fine and fresh with a very limited production.

With a proud history dating back to the 1950s Marie Demets is a family-owned champagne house nestled in Gyé-sur-Seine, in the Aube region of Champagne. Today, Pierre Demets and his wife Mathilde meticulously manage every step of the champagne-making process, from tending their 10+ hectares of vineyards to bottling and shipping. Their passion translates into champagnes praised for their quality and balance.
